演绎数据库是什么
-
数据库是一个用来存储和管理数据的系统。它可以提供高效的数据存储和检索功能,以及数据的安全性和完整性保证。数据库可以被用于各种应用领域,包括商业、科学、教育等。
以下是关于数据库的一些重要概念和特点:
-
数据库管理系统(DBMS):数据库管理系统是一个软件,用于管理数据库的创建、访问、更新和删除操作。它提供了一个接口,允许用户通过查询语言(如SQL)与数据库进行交互。
-
数据模型:数据库使用数据模型来描述和组织数据。常见的数据模型包括层次模型、网络模型、关系模型等。关系模型是最常用的模型,它使用表格来表示数据,并通过表格之间的关系来表示数据之间的联系。
-
数据表:数据表是数据库中存储数据的基本单位。它由行和列组成,每一行代表一个记录,每一列代表一个字段。数据表可以通过主键和外键来建立关联关系。
-
数据库查询语言:数据库查询语言用于从数据库中检索和操作数据。SQL是最常用的查询语言,它允许用户通过简单的语句来查询和更新数据库中的数据。
-
数据库事务:数据库事务是指一组数据库操作的逻辑单元,它要么全部执行成功,要么全部失败。数据库管理系统使用事务来保证数据的一致性和完整性,通过事务的提交和回滚机制来确保数据的正确性。
总结起来,数据库是一个用于存储和管理数据的系统,它使用数据模型来描述和组织数据,通过数据库管理系统提供的查询语言来操作数据。数据库具有高效的数据存储和检索功能,以及数据的安全性和完整性保证。
1年前 -
-
演绎数据库是一种用于存储和管理数据的系统。它可以用来存储各种类型的数据,包括文本、数字、图像、音频和视频等。演绎数据库通过建立数据模型和数据关系,提供了一种结构化的方式来组织和访问数据。
演绎数据库的主要功能包括数据的存储、检索、更新和删除。它可以通过查询语言(如SQL)来进行数据的检索和操作。演绎数据库还支持事务处理,保证了数据的一致性和完整性。
演绎数据库的优点包括:
- 数据的结构化和组织化,便于数据的管理和维护;
- 高效的数据访问和查询,提高了数据的检索和操作效率;
- 支持并发访问和事务处理,保证了数据的一致性和完整性;
- 提供了数据的备份和恢复机制,保证了数据的安全性;
- 支持数据的共享和分布式处理,便于多个应用程序之间共享数据。
演绎数据库主要有关系数据库和非关系数据库两种类型。关系数据库采用表格的形式来组织数据,通过关系模型来描述数据之间的关系。非关系数据库则采用其他数据结构,如图形、文档或键值对等来组织数据。
总之,演绎数据库是一种用于存储和管理数据的系统,它提供了结构化的方式来组织和访问数据,并支持高效的数据检索、更新和删除操作。它的优点包括数据的结构化和组织化、高效的数据访问和查询、支持并发访问和事务处理、提供数据的备份和恢复机制,以及支持数据的共享和分布式处理等。
1年前 -
数据库是指存储和管理数据的系统,它可以用来存储结构化数据(如表格、关系数据等)和非结构化数据(如文本、图像、音频等)。数据库系统提供了一种机制,可以有效地组织和访问数据,以满足用户的需求。
演绎数据库的内容可以从以下几个方面进行讲解。
-
数据库的定义和特点
- 数据库是一个有组织的集合,用于存储和管理数据。
- 数据库具有持久性,即数据在数据库中持续存在,即使系统关闭或断电也不会丢失。
- 数据库支持数据的高效检索和操作,可以快速访问和处理大量数据。
-
数据库的分类
- 关系型数据库:使用表格来组织和存储数据,并通过SQL语言进行操作和查询。常见的关系型数据库有MySQL、Oracle、SQL Server等。
- 非关系型数据库:使用其他数据结构来存储和组织数据,如键值对、文档、图形等。常见的非关系型数据库有MongoDB、Redis、Cassandra等。
-
数据库的组成部分
- 数据库管理系统(DBMS):是控制数据库的软件,负责创建、维护和管理数据库。
- 数据库:存储和组织数据的集合,由一个或多个表格组成。
- 表格(表):用于存储数据的二维结构,由行和列组成。
- 列(字段):表格中的一个数据项,用于存储一个特定类型的数据。
- 行(记录):表格中的一组数据,包含了一条完整的数据记录。
-
数据库的操作
- 创建数据库:使用DBMS提供的命令或图形界面工具创建数据库。
- 创建表格:定义表格的结构,包括列的名称、类型和约束等。
- 插入数据:将数据插入到表格中,使用INSERT语句或图形界面工具。
- 更新数据:修改表格中的数据,使用UPDATE语句或图形界面工具。
- 删除数据:从表格中删除数据,使用DELETE语句或图形界面工具。
- 查询数据:从表格中检索数据,使用SELECT语句或图形界面工具。
-
数据库的设计和规范化
- 数据库设计:根据系统需求和数据关系,设计数据库的结构和关系。
- 规范化:通过消除冗余和不一致性,提高数据库的性能和数据的一致性。
-
数据库的安全性和备份
- 用户权限管理:限制用户对数据库的访问和操作权限,保护数据的安全性。
- 数据备份和恢复:定期备份数据库,以防止数据丢失或损坏。
通过以上的演绎,我们可以了解到数据库的定义、特点、分类、组成部分、操作、设计和安全性等方面的知识。数据库是现代信息系统中不可或缺的一部分,对于数据的存储、管理和访问起着重要的作用。
1年前 -